People´s Democratic Republic of ETHIOPIA
(Addis Ababa)

People´s Democratic Republic of ETHIOPIA

Flag or logo since 1987-09-12*
YE-ĪTYŌṗṗYĀ Dīmōkrāsīyāwī Rīpeblīk : የኢትዮጵያ ሕዝባዊ ዲሞክራሲያዊ ሪፐብሊክ (am) UNO Member
Emblem or Symbol*

President Mengistu Haile Mariam
(ruler of ETHIOPIA since 1977-02-03)
 
 
 
 
Capitals & administrative places*: Addis Ababa
(Addis Abeba)
Official & national languages: Amharic (am) .
